With the hashtag #TeamShaggy4Kids floating all around social media last Saturday night, there was no doubt, the place to be was on the Lawns of Jamaica House for the fifth staging of the Shaggy and Friends 2016 benefit concert. Indeed, even Prime Minister Portia Simpson Miller was in attendance, and made an impromptu appearance on stage to “settle the score” when Ity & Fancy Cat poked fun at her as part of their comedic set. Thousands of patrons streamed into the arena-styled venue, filled with WATA and CranWATA igloos, food stations stocked with scrumptious fare catered by some of our local culinary personalities; and libations aplenty (see more in the pages of Thursday Life).
